Comparing Artificial Intelligence: Siri v/s Bixby

The world of smartphone virtual assistant has long been dominated by Apple’s Siri. Now we have some competition for it through its arch rival Samsung. Samsung S8 comes with a fully functional virtual assistant, which goes by the name Bixby. It is way better than Samsung’s S- voice that was available in a few older Samsung smartphones. Given below are a few key features of Bixby, and how it fares in comparison with Siri.


1. Button Activation – 

Unlike Siri, Bixby does not need voice activation, but can instead start operation with a press of a button. Once it is activated, you can task it with anything you wish to do on your smartphone. According to Samsung, this voice assistant has the potential to perform 15,000 different tasks, but that does not include sending an email.

2. Supports Augmented Reality - 

The Bixby Vision feature of the virtual assistant allows it to identify objects in real time. If you come across something interesting online, you can click a picture of the same and the mobile camera will be used to deliver its price online, reviews, as well as other similar recommendations. This kind of feature is present only in Google’s devices, apart from Samsung.

3. Native App Reminder Feature – 

The Bixby home allows the virtual assistant to give you reminders on the basis of the apps you make use of on a daily basis. This can include paying your rent, watching a saved video, setting an alarm, etc.  The reminder feature of Bixby is considered to be more robust and efficient as compared to siri, primarily because is resides in the native mobile apps, and learns from your usage of the apps.
